JOB PERFORMANCE OF ADMINISTRATIVE EMPLOYEE IN SURABAYA: THE ROLE OF WORK ENVIRONMENT AND CAREER DEVELOPMENT

Enrico Kevin Singkali, Fenika Wulani, P. Julius F. Nagel

Abstract


This research aims to identify the impact of work environment and career development on job performance. Data was collected by distributing questionnaires to administrative employees in Surabaya. The data collected and can be used in hypothesis testing are 101 respondent data. Hypothesis testing was carried out using multiple linear regression in the SPSS 23.0 program. The findings of this study support the research hypothesis, namely that work environment and career development significantly have a positive effect on job performance of administrative employees in Surabaya
